TRANSACTIONS OF THE BRISTOL AND GLOUCESTERSHIRE ARCHAEOLOGICAL SOCIETY VOL XXIV PART I

Published by Bristol and Gloucestershire Archaeological Society. 1901

Poor condition. Grey card wraps. Colour folding plan. B/w photos. Contains: The Halleway Chauntry at the Parish Church of All Saints Bristol; The Architecture of Hayles Abbey; Bristol City Coat of Arms; The Family of Catgchmay;Note on Hidcote House; Aust The Place of Meeting; The Hospital of St. John Bristol.

Contents very good. Lacks spine, covers detached.
